Michael Selig Nominated as CFTC Chair, Promoting Crypto Regulation

BY Joshua Trelawen·2 MIN READ·OCTOBER 25, 2025

Michael Selig has been nominated by President Donald Trump to lead the Commodity Futures Trading Commission, marking a potential shift towards unified crypto regulation in the U.S.

Michael Selig has been nominated as Chair of the Commodity Futures Trading Commission. This move by President Donald Trump seeks to promote a unified approach to crypto regulation.

Selig’s experience includes previous roles as SEC Chief Counsel and work under former CFTC Chairman Chris Giancarlo. He is an expert in aligning crypto policies across regulatory bodies.

His nomination is expected to address regulatory ambiguities, benefiting custody providers and trading platforms. The potential increase in institutional involvement could also affect U.S. Bitcoin ETFs.

The market anticipates increased capital flow into assets like BTC, ETH, and stablecoins due to clear regulations and institutional participation. DeFi could see positive growth, enhancing its appeal to investors.

Market experts predict Selig’s leadership might drive policy that fosters innovation-friendly environments. His familiarity with digital asset legislation augments hopes for successful U.S. regulatory frameworks. Twitter Source

Similar past regulatory events have led to price appreciation in affected tokens and boosted trading volumes. The efforts to clarify rules aim to accelerate adoption and institutional interest in cryptocurrencies.

Michael Selig, currently SEC crypto counsel, is recognized as a “dual agency” expert, expected to help harmonize crypto regulation and policy across the SEC and CFTC – source.
